CHANGES.md view
@@ -1,3 +1,18 @@+0.8.0+=====++* [#83](https://github.com/serokell/universum/issues/83):+ Change the order of types in `show` and `print` functions.+* Move string related reexports and functions to `Conv` module.+* Rename `Conv` module to `String`.+* Move `print` function to `Print` module.++0.7.2+=======++* [#77](https://github.com/serokell/universum/issues/77):+ Add `modify'` function to export list.+ 0.7.1.1 =======
